Transaction 59776a2fe2e90d52104b826882fd8715d8bfa5baad884c68862d9fdafff7e136

1 Input
2 Outputs
  • 59776a2fe2e90d52104b826882fd8715d8bfa5baad884c68862d9fdafff7e136:0
  • value  376900
    address  1HgGRJHXGWRjUriT6FgeUy7tKXLkoNk2sj
  • 59776a2fe2e90d52104b826882fd8715d8bfa5baad884c68862d9fdafff7e136:1
  • value  121088160
    address  bc1qg9lgqyukp2rup5x4frrz7hhw7988k5q26luakm